摘要
本文全面介绍TPWallet最新版的“验证密码”机制:设计原理、抗木马对策、与智能化金融支付的结合,以及在数字化未来世界和矿场环境下的行业发展分析,并讨论用Golang实现与部署建议。
一、验证密码概述
TPWallet最新版将传统静态密码升级为“验证密码”体系,集成多因素验证(MFA)、行为绑定与动态口令:
- 动态码:基于时间或事件的TOTP/OTP,一次性生效。
- 行为指纹:设备指纹、操作行为与惯性数据,提高异地登录识别能力。
- 软硬件隔离:敏感密钥存于TEE或安全芯片,App仅保留不可导出凭证摘要。
二、防木马与安全防护策略
- 内存保护与防篡改:关键运算在受保护的进程或硬件内完成,使用代码完整性校验并定期自检。
- 反注入与反调试:运行时检测调试器、注入库与Hook行为,异常则降级或锁定账户。
- 网络层加密:端到端加密(E2EE)+前向保密(PFS),防止会话被回放或中间人攻击。
- 策略化告警与应急:设备异常、交易异常触发风控链路并进入人工复核。
三、Golang在实现中的作用
- 服务端并发能力:Golang适合高并发验证请求的网关、签名服务与风控决策引擎。
- 安全库与审计:推荐使用经过审计的加密库(例如golang.org/x/crypto),并在关键模块做Fuzz与静态分析。
- 部署与容器化:Golang二进制体积小,易于在边缘节点或矿场旁的网关设备中部署。
四、智能化金融支付的融合
- 实时风控:将验证密码的行为数据喂入AI模型,实现智能风控与动态认证策略调整(例如对高风险交易追加人脸或视频验证)。
- 无缝体验:在确保安全的前提下,通过生物与行为认证减少用户输入频率,提升支付转化率。

五、数字化未来世界与行业发展分析

- 去中心化与信任重构:钱包类产品向“身份+资产”统一平台演进,验证密码成为跨链、跨平台的统一认证层。
- 合规与隐私保护并重:监管要求KYC/AML与隐私保护(差分隐私、联邦学习)并行,行业将形成合规+技术双轨发展。
- 矿场与算力资源的影响:矿场作为算力与边缘基础设施,可能承载验证任务和零知识证明的批量验证,推动验证服务的集中化与规模化,但也带来监管与集中化风险。
六、实施建议与最佳实践
- 最低权限与密钥分离:服务端执行最小权限原则,密钥管理使用KMS/硬件模块。
- 定期红队测试:模拟木马与侧信道攻击场景,验证验证密码体系的弹性。
- 可解释的AI风控:风控模型要具备可解释性与审计日志,方便合规与追责。
- 混合部署策略:核心验证服务放在云端受控环境,延迟敏感或隐私敏感模块在设备或边缘(Golang网关)运行。
结论
TPWallet最新版的验证密码体系以动态、多因素与行为绑定为核心,结合Golang实现的高性能后端与智能风控,可以有效提升抗木马能力并适配智能化金融支付场景。在数字化未来与矿场资源重构的大背景下,行业将朝向合规化、可解释AI与去中心化信任层演进,但需警惕集中化风险与隐私合规挑战。
评论
AlexChen
写得很详细,特别是Golang在高并发验证中的应用,很受用。
墨轩
关于矿场承担验证任务的风险分析很到位,值得金融机构关注。
Sophie_Li
期待看到更多关于TEE和硬件隔离的实现细节与开源实践建议。
周子辰
建议补充对移动端SDK防护(反逆向、白盒加密)的具体方案。
Tech漫步者
结合AI风控与可解释性那段很关键,实际落地时合规团队会很需要这种说明。